Default want to have dvd

I really want to be able to play DVD's on my screen up front.

In my 2006 gs300 I do NOT have navi.

What i want to know is if i get a new head unit( factory unit with screen) that has the navi button on it, can i play dvds on it or will i need the dvd drive that goes in the glove box as well? and If the new unit plays dvds will it have the dvd logo on the front of the unit?

you can play DVD on any screen

All you need is a navi/TV kit and a separate DVD player that should easily fit in the glove box. You will have a switch to toggle from DVD to OEM. I have done it in other cars and it works good. I believe we have a vendor on here that sells the kit you need. Its very easy to install. You could go as far as placing monitors in the rear of the headrests while you are at it
